Gavin M. Mudd is a lecturer in the Department of Environmental Engineering at Monash University, Australia. He was awarded a Ph.D. in environmental engineering in 2001, from the Victoria University of Technology.〔(Dr Gavin Mudd )〕 Mudd's research interests range from urban groundwater management to sustainable mining.〔 In October 2007, Gavin Mudd completed a report on Australia's Mining Industry entitled ''The Sustainability of Mining in Australia: Key Production Trends and Their Environmental Implications for the Future.''〔(The Sustainability of Mining in Australia: Key Production Trends and Their Environmental Implications for the Future )〕 ==Selected recent publications〔== *(''Sustainability of Uranium Mining and Milling: Toward Quantifying Resources and Eco-Efficiency'' ) *''Global Trends in Gold Mining : Towards Quantifying Environmental and Resource Sustainability?''
